تحركات عسكرية Brotherhood moves in Abyan torpedo the Riyadh Agreement and threaten the Leadership Council - Thursday 19 May 2022 الساعة 06:06 pm مشاركة Abyan, NewsYemen, private:  The movements of the Brotherhood’s army in the Ahwar district of Abyan governorate, in the south of the country, threaten the consensus of the Presidential Command Council and its directions to complete the implementation of the security and military part of the Riyadh Agreement, which provides for the withdrawal of all military forces from Abyan towards areas of confrontation against the Houthi militias.

The Ministry of Defense website said, on Wednesday, that a joint security force from the Abyan axis, which is under the control of the Brotherhood, carried out a field descent to the Ahwar district, claiming to secure the international line linking the governorates of Aden and Hadhramaut.

According to the military website, the command of the joint security force consisted of Brigadier General Louay Awad al-Zamki, staff of the Abyan axis, commander of the 3rd Brigade, Presidential Guard, Colonel Ali Saeed al-Omeisy, head of joint forces operations in Abyan axis, Brigadier General Abdul Qader al-Jaari, commander of the 103rd Infantry Brigade, and Brigadier General Muhammad Ali Jabr, commander the 89th Infantry Brigade, Colonel Al-Khader Corner Muhammad Al-Tali, Staff of the 115th Infantry Brigade, and the battalion leaders in the aforementioned brigades.

These moves, which apparently took place without coordination with the leadership of the fourth military region, which is located in the deployment area within the scope of its theater of operations, were rejected by the leadership of the 111th Brigade stationed in the Ahwar district led by Brigadier General Muhammad Ahmed Mulhim, who confirmed that the entry of Al-Zamki forces into the district is an explicit violation of military laws  And he violated the Riyadh Agreement, noting that what Al-Zamki forces had done was a clear occupation and invasion of the district, and a disdain and mockery of the forces of the 111th Brigade present in the district.

In its statement, the command of the brigade accused al-Zamki's forces of seeking to spread conflict, sedition and terrorism in Ahwar by setting up checkpoints and levies to loot money from the coastal line that connects the capital, Aden and Hadhramaut.

The leadership of the 111th Brigade confirmed its categorical refusal to submit to the Abyan axis, as it is under the control of the Fourth Military District, blaming Al-Zamki's forces for any problems in Ahwar.
